分布式系统实践 1. 一文读懂大数据计算框架与平台 http://dwz.cn/5SgDC5 摘要: 这篇文章从批处理模型, 流式计算模型和交互式分析模型三个角度总结了开源大数据框架的特点, 对于大家了解大数据平台的全貌有一定的帮助. 2. 美团的大数据平台架构实践 http://dwz.cn/5T ...
分类:
其他好文 时间:
2017-05-05 21:51:02
阅读次数:
182
上篇说道了数据库读写分离,对于大型网站来说这么说是十分有必要的。数据库在整个互联网架构中担当的角色无法有两个,存储和运算,很多时候这两个是并存的,但是在后期,对于上亿条数据来说,让数据库既要存储,又要运算,那么是这是不可行的,为了保证性能,我们仅仅只需要最大化利用DB的存数就行了,连数据库之间的外键 ...
分类:
数据库 时间:
2017-05-04 11:02:41
阅读次数:
240
我们要搭建轻量级的架构,首先要确保有一套轻量高效的“辅助工具”,确保平台架构能够正常推进。 项目的“辅助工具”包含协作平台,管理工具。 首先来说说 项目协作工具 比較老旧的团队协作,都是枯燥的会议记录。列表式的Task,还有附件形式的项目文档... 非常多公司总是想通过这些方式来把控项目,觉得有“协 ...
分类:
其他好文 时间:
2017-05-02 16:05:37
阅读次数:
202
解密淘宝网的开源架构作者:曾宪杰。2002年毕业于浙江大学计算机系。先后在中科院下属企业、先锋电子(中国)就职。积累了丰富的Windows平台、企业级系统设计经验。现任淘宝网平台架构部架构师,主要研究方向为大规模集群环境下的消息中间件设计、分布式数据层和分布式系统。淘宝..
分类:
其他好文 时间:
2017-04-26 10:08:12
阅读次数:
186
上篇文章大致降了网站架构的一个大致发展趋势,这篇咱们讲讲数据库。数据库在大并发的情况下是最容易出现问题的,往往都是由于写操作引发的网站访问缓慢或者崩溃,之前说过12306就是这个问题。 大并发的时候,打个比方,上下班高峰期经常会堵车,我们把并发访问量当做车流量,某个路段路口比作数据库,某路口就这么大 ...
分类:
Web程序 时间:
2017-04-24 12:12:21
阅读次数:
161
朋友公司的产品已经做了11个年头了,在餐饮业可以说数一数二,网站架构从原始的单一应用一直演变至今,已经十分庞大了,不说完美,但是可支撑的业务量已经十分强大。最近受邀参与了他们的架构分享会,在此我也总结一下大致内容,一方面当做会议纪要,一方面也总结分享给大家看看。 先看一下初期架构,前期网站平台刚刚建 ...
分类:
Web程序 时间:
2017-04-18 14:00:45
阅读次数:
219
何涛 唯品会平台架构师 何涛,现任职于唯品会平台架构部,要负责数据访问层,网关,数据库中间件,平台框架等开发设计工作。在数据库性能优化,架构设计等方面有着大量的经验积累。热衷于高可用,高并发及高性能的架构研究。 大家可能会有这样疑问:连接池类似于线程池或者对象池,就是一个放连接的池子,使用的时候从里 ...
分类:
数据库 时间:
2017-04-13 11:52:27
阅读次数:
222
购物车主要作用在于:1、和传统卖场类似,方便用户一次选择多件商品去结算。2、充当临时收藏夹的功能。3、对于商家来说,购物车是向用户推销的最佳场所之一。 早期 ERP拆分 业务服务化拆分 WCS拆分 购物车功能模块概况 层级设计 群集设计 云购物车从应用层 面上设计了三个—— 交互层、业务... ...
分类:
其他好文 时间:
2017-04-09 11:48:46
阅读次数:
380
从平台架构师的视角看<微信&小程序>平台化策略By高焕堂2017/03/101、微信&小程序(SP)的角色微信的创始人张小龙先生是一位非常杰出的产品和平台设计师。他最近开始让著名的微信(WeChat)产品逐渐迈向平台化,并且巧妙地设计了<小程序(SP)>来衔接到QQ云平台。..
分类:
微信 时间:
2017-03-11 22:14:23
阅读次数:
462
构建高并发高可用的电商平台架构实践(上) 一、 设计理念 1. 空间换时间 1) 多级缓存,静态化 客户端页面缓存(http header中包含Expires/Cache of Control,last modified(304,server不返回body,客户端可以继续用cache,减少流量),E ...
分类:
其他好文 时间:
2017-03-08 23:01:20
阅读次数:
230